National Bank of Ukraine (NBU) announced the main trend of payment systems’ development in the country.
According to the results of Ukrainian banks activity at payment cards market in Q1, 2009, the total number of active cards – more than 44 million. The number of cards using which cardholders made at least one transaction reduced by 20% from 38 million to 30 million. The number of ATMs increased and reached 28,000 units, and the number of POS-terminals reduced by almost 10,000 devices and amounted to about 107,000.
NBU also reported about current position of National System of Mass Electronic Payments (NSMEP). To the beginning of May, 2009, 53 institutions are participants of NSMEP, among them there are 51 banks (including NBU) and 2 non-banking institutions. NSMEP works in commercial operation mode since 2004, turnover of the System amounts to almost UAH83 billion (USD10 billion).
